Description
The sitting room includes a sash bay window, picture rail, cornice, and stripped wooden flooring, while the spacious dining room features a cast iron fireplace and under-stairs storage. The fitted kitchen offers wall and base units, tiled floor, and plumbing for appliances. A modern ground floor shower room is positioned at the rear. Upstairs are three well-proportioned bedrooms, all with sash windows and stripped wooden floors. The first-floor shower room includes a double shower, WC, and wash basin.
Outside, there is a walled front garden and a low-maintenance rear patio garden with a shed and passageway access.
